Deleting a transmitter

Deleting a transmitter will remove the connection between
the transmitter and the app. You will no longer be able to
use the transmitter.
If you want to use the transmitter again in the future, you
will need to go through the steps to connect the transmit-
ter.

Meters

When using the GlucoMen Day CGM, always carry a blood
glucose meter for calibrating the system.
The calibration can be performed by using the GlucoMen
Day METER system (provided separately), or by any com-
mercially available blood glucose meter.
9.1

Navigating to the Meters screen

If you use the GlucoMen Day METER system to measure
your blood glucose (provided separately), you can con-
nect the meter to the app so that blood glucose readin-
gs automatically transfer to the app and you can select
them for calibration.
